Abstract:
By using GIS and different factors influnced over water potenial of rock and alluvial unites in Arak-Mighan watershed, we determind area has water. We prepared maps such as geology, geomorphology, rain, fault density, electric conductivity, and well density and composed using GIS and produced a lot of pollygons. Each pollygon has a degree based on influenced factors. Therefore, there formed homogen polygon and discriminated priority area for water potential.
